Chelsea have finalized an £18.5m agreement to sign promising Sporting CP midfielder Dario Essugo, currently on loan at Las Palmas.

The 20-year-old is set to sign a seven-year contract, with an option for an additional year, pending a medical and personal terms agreement.
Essugo, a Portugal Under-21 international, is expected to join the squad in June, providing depth in the defensive midfield role alongside Moises Caicedo.
His impressive development this season has caught the attention of Chelsea scouts, with club insiders confident in his potential.
